The National Monuments Service's description
On poorly drained land 25m N of a watercourse that marks the townland boundary with Dunkip. Not depicted on OSi historic maps. Identified as a circular cropmark from examination of aerial photograph (BGE 1:5000 No. 37) of the region taken 03/11/1984 associated with Bord Gáis Éireann pipeline. Visible as a roughly circular-shaped area (diam. c. 16m) enclosed by a bank on OSi orthophoto taken between 2005-2012 and on Google Earth orthoimage dated 14/02/2020. Visible on Google Earth orthoimages as a circular-shaped area intersected at N by an old meandering water channel running roughly E-W.
